Responsibilities

  • Review, modify and prepare moderately complex templates, letters, reports, PowerPoint presentations, Word documents, Excel workbooks and other correspondence materials; research, compile and summarize information/data
  • Support leader(s) through calendar and email management, invoicing and A/R
  • Enter, review and maintain client accounts and contact information in the Client Relationship Management (CRM) platform
  • Review upcoming deadlines and work requirements with the team; coordinate the logistics and flow of work to specific team members (i.e., documents for review/signature)
  • Record minutes at various meetings and distribute or archive them accordingly
  • Prepare and submit expense reports
  • Coordinate and schedule internal and external meeting and appointment logistics and prepare supporting material
  • Coordinate travel arrangements and reservations
  • Maintain electronic and paper filing systems
  • Contribute to the development of new ideas and approaches to improve work processes
  • Work collaboratively with other team members and leadership
  • Maintain flexibility to work overtime, as necessary

Skills and Experience

  • Post-secondary education in business administration is considered an asset
  • Experience in a professional services environment is considered an asset
  • Demonstrated willingness to learn and grow, with a strong interest in developing skills within the role
  • Tech-savvy with an openness to leveraging new tools, including AI, to improve efficiency and outcomes
  • Proactive and self-motivated, with the ability to take initiative and contribute ideas
  • Collaborative team player with strong interpersonal and communication skills
  • Strong client service focus in dealing with both external and internal clients
  • Excellent organizational and time management skills, with the ability to manage multiple tasks simultaneously
